About Little Nelchina State Recreation Area
How does a quiet escape into Alaska’s untamed wilderness sound? The Little Nelchina State Recreation Area Campground offers a tranquil retreat just off the Glenn Highway, where the soothing murmur of the nearby Little Nelchina River provides a natural soundtrack. Known for its remote charm, this modest former campground features eight basic sites, two rustic outhouses, and no maintained amenities—perfect for those seeking simplicity and solitude in the backcountry.
Situated near Mile 138, this primitive site grants access to fishing opportunities in the adjacent river while offering a peaceful setting free from the distractions of modern life. Though not actively maintained, the area remains a go-to for tent campers and smaller RVs looking for a serene stopover or a weekend getaway amidst the rugged Alaskan landscape. The lack of water and managed facilities requires campers to plan ahead, but the reward is an unspoiled environment where nature takes center stage.
